IP address 217.35.12.27 lookup, whois and location finder

IP address  217.35.12.27
217.35.12.27  United Kingdom
IPv4
217.35.12.27
BT
BT
217.35.12.24 - 217.35.12.31
Europe/London (UTC0)
United Kingdom 
Luton
Luton
51.88330078125, -0.41670000553131
Show
Connection type cable or DSL